Determination of sex in South Indians and immigrant Tibetans from cephalometric analysis and discriminant functions.

Abstract

Skeletal components play significant role in sex determination in forensic and anthropological fields. Skull is considered second best, after pelvis, in determination of sex. Methods based on morphological characteristics and morphometry are already in use with reasonable accuracy. Standardized radiographic techniques like cephalometry have advantages of being more precise and objective when compared to morphologic methods. The present study aimed at obtaining and comparing the reliability of cranio-mandibular parameters in South Indian and Indian immigrant of Tibetan populations using lateral and postero-anterior (PA) cephalograms. A total of 11 cephalometric parameters were traced on lateral and PA cephalograms manually. Functions to aid in the sex determination were developed by subjecting the cephalometric parameters to discriminant analysis. Among the chosen parameters bizygomatic width, ramus height, depth of face contributed most for sexual dimorphism in both the populations. Upper facial height was the additional parameter for sexual dimorphism in immigrant Tibetan population. The discrimination accuracy in South Indian population was 81.5% while that of immigrant Tibetan population was 88.2%. With the current study it can be concluded that cephalometric cranio-mandibular parameters can be used to discriminate the sex using discriminant function analysis and similar cranio-mandibular parameters contribute to sex prediction across populations.

摘要

骨骼成分在法医学和人类学领域的性别确定中起着重要作用。在性别确定方面,颅骨被认为仅次于骨盆,是第二好的。基于形态特征和形态计量学的方法已经在使用,具有相当的准确性。与形态学方法相比,标准化的放射技术,如头颅测量法具有更精确和客观的优点。本研究旨在通过侧位和后前位(PA)头颅片获得并比较印度南部和印度藏族移民的颅颌参数的可靠性。总共手动追踪了侧位和 PA 头颅片上的 11 个头影测量参数。通过对这些头影测量参数进行判别分析,建立了辅助性别鉴定的函数。在所选择的参数中,双侧颧骨宽度、下颌支高度、面深对两个群体的性别二态性贡献最大。在上部面高是移民藏族群体性别二态性的附加参数。印度南部人群的判别准确率为 81.5%,而移民藏族人群的判别准确率为 88.2%。通过本研究可以得出结论,使用判别函数分析可以对头影测量的颅颌参数进行性别区分,相似的颅颌参数有助于跨人群进行性别预测。
